Output e504a69528f6edc09c89c4cb4607f963acda5e9571f9a22d65f75b41964f62de:8

value
997859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 712e7c538bbf8babf37449f72e883042bd9d4a66 OP_EQUAL
address
3C1Ty6mCmcaM3VXdC3hocPYi3SXiWgFVsA
transaction
e504a69528f6edc09c89c4cb4607f963acda5e9571f9a22d65f75b41964f62de